About us

Since its foundation in 2001, the Society of Construction Law Hong Kong (SCLHK) has worked to promote for the public benefit education, study and research in the field of construction law and related subjects (including ADR, arbitration and adjudication). SCLHK is affiliated with and shares similar objects with the UK-based Society of Construction Law (SCLUK), established in 1983. The Society of Construction Law Hong Kong now has about 250 members from all sectors of the construction industry. The Society holds frequent meetings and other events.
